Full Stack Developer Course

Master Program 4.9 Reviews 12k+ Learners
Enroll Now - November Batch Only 5 Seats Left Download Syllabus
5 Students Batch
10+ Live Projects
100% Job Assistance
350+ Hrs Duration

You Will Learn

HTML5
CSS3
Bootstrap
JavaScript
React JS
Angular
Front End Project - I, II
Java
Spring Boot
Python
Django
My-SQL
Mongo-DB
Rest API
GitHub
Full Stack Project - III

Why Hejex Outranks others in Full Stack Developer Course?

Gain real-world skills through hands-on projects, daily mentorship, and expert guidance in our full stack course.

Features Hejex Technology Other Institutes
Batch Size 5–10 Students 30–60 Students
Duration 350+ Hours Intensive 100–150 Hours
Trainers MNC Experts Freelancers / Freshers
Career Preparation 100% with Dedicated Team Limited / None
Projects 5+ Real-time Projects None
Daily Hours 3.5 Hours Per Day 1.5 Hours Per Day
Weekly Days 6 Days 5 Days
EMI Options 3 Installments Mostly One Time Payment
Find a Right Place for Bright Career

About Hejex Technology

Hejex Technology is a leading software training institute in Chennai, offering a wide range of IT and software development courses for aspiring professionals. Whether you are a beginner starting your journey in the tech industry or an experienced developer looking to enhance your skills, Hejex Technology provides industry-aligned training programs designed to meet real-world demands. With expert mentors, hands-on projects, and placement-focused learning, Hejex Technology stands out as one of the best institutes for Full Stack Developer training in Chennai.

classroom 1

Placed Students Reviews

Our Alumni Works at

Hejex Technology Full Stack Course in Placements

Don't Miss Out!

Join the Hejex Technology Full Stack Web Development Program. Join the Hejex Technology Full Stack Web Development Program. Take part in practical projects. Develop key skills , and enhance your credibility in order to advance your career as a full stack developer.

Request a Call Back

Full Stack Syllabus

Module 1: HTML & CSS

  • Introduction to FrontEnd
  • Types of Websites
  • Fundamental of HTML
  • HTML Elements
  • HTML Tags
  • HTML List
  • HTML Tables
  • HTML Forms
  • Introduction to CSS
  • Types of CSS
  • CSS Selectors
  • CSS Colors
  • CSS Background
  • CSS BoxModel
  • CSS Margin
  • CSS padding
  • CSS Text
  • CSS Font

  • Introduction to Bootstrap
  • Grid System
  • Resonsive Website
  • Typography
  • Button & Button Groups
  • Glypicon
  • Pagination
  • Dropdown
  • Collapse
  • NavBar
  • Forms
  • Carousel

  • Introduction to JavaScript
  • Variables & Datatypes
  • Conditional Statements
  • Looping Structure
  • Functions
  • JS Arrays
  • JS Strings
  • JS DOM
  • JS Validation
  • ES6 Intro
  • ES6 Variables
  • ES6 Functions
  • ES6 Spread Operator
  • ES6 Map Objects
  • ES6 Set Objects
  • ES6 Classes
  • ES6 Promises

  • React JS Intro
  • React JS Installation
  • React JSX
  • React JS Components
  • React JS State & Props
  • Component Lifecycle
  • React Forms
  • React CSS
  • React Bootstrap
  • Hooks Intro
  • Hook Effects
  • Custom Hooks
  • Basic Hooks
  • React Router DOM

  • Introduction to Java
  • Fundamentals of Java Programming
  • Installation
  • JDK,JRE,JVM
  • Datatypes
  • Variables
  • Class & Objects
  • Methods in Java
  • Conditional Statements
  • Looping Structures
  • Nested Loops
  • Java Arrays
  • Java Strings
  • Introduction to OOPS
  • Class & Objects
  • Constructors
  • Inheritance
  • Polymorphism
  • Encapsulation
  • Data Abstraction
  • Static Variables Methods
  • Final Keyword
  • Interface
  • Exception Handling
  • File Handling
  • Collections

  • JDBC Intro
  • JDBC Configuration
  • Connection Object
  • Statement Type
  • Statement Object
  • Result Set
  • Row Set
  • JDBC CRUD

  • Spring Boot Intro
  • Spring Boot App
  • Spring Initializr
  • Auto Configuration
  • Spring Boot Annotations
  • Entity Creation
  • Repository Creation
  • Controller Creation
  • J-Unit Test Case
  • Accessing data with Spring Boot
  • Configuring Spring Boot withMVC
  • Building a Restful Application

  • Introduction to Python
  • Fundamentals of Python
  • Installation of Python
  • Variables
  • Datatypes
  • Output & Input
  • Conditional Statements
  • Looping Structure
  • Functions
  • Introduction Data Structure
  • List
  • Tuple
  • Dicitionary
  • Sets
  • Strings
  • Introduction to Objet Oriented Programming
  • Class & Objects
  • Constructor
  • Inheritance
  • Polymorphism
  • Encapsulation
  • Data Abstraction
  • Exception handling
  • File Handling

  • Django Intro
  • Django Project
  • Web Project
  • Django App
  • Django Views
  • Django URLS
  • Django Templates
  • Migration

  • Models Intro
  • Create Table
  • Migration
  • View SQL Lite
  • CRUD
  • Main Index
  • Django 404
  • Test View
  • Django Admin
  • Static Files
  • Deploy Django

  • MySQL Intro
  • What is Database?
  • RDBMS vs DBMS
  • What is MySQL?
  • MySQL Data Types
  • Database Creation
  • Table Creation
  • ALTER TABLE Statement
  • SELECT Statement
  • DELETE Statement
  • Primary Key Constraint
  • FOREIGN KEY Constraint

  • API Intro
  • Web Service
  • Rest API
  • Architecture
  • Get & Post
  • Put & Delete
  • Integration
Download Syllabus (PDF)

Pick Your Slots

Monday – Saturday

IST (GMT +5:30)

Monday – Saturday

IST (GMT +5:30)

Monday – Saturday

IST (GMT +5:30)

Monday – Saturday

IST (GMT +5:30)

Find a Right Place for Bright Career

Key Highlights

100% Placement Assistance

Get dedicated career guidance, resume building, and mock interviews all while you train. We’ll help you land your dream job with full placement assistance throughout the course.

Flexible Learning Options

Learn the way that works best for you choose between classroom training or live online sessions. Our Full Stack Developer Course is designed to fit your schedule and learning style.

Certified Industry Experts

Learn from experienced professionals working in top MNCs each with over 10 years of real-world project expertise in Full Stack Development.

Placement Guidance

Boost your confidence for top tech roles with technical MCQs, mock interviews, and hands-on guidance throughout your Full Stack Developer training.

Hands-On Real-Time Projects

Gain practical experience by building full stack applications from scratch — including front-end, back-end, database integration, and API calls.

Comprehensive Curriculum

Master both front-end and back-end development through a structured, industry-aligned Full Stack Developer Course designed to make you job-ready.

Master Full Stack Development Course

HTML & CSS

Learn to create the structure and layout of web pages using HTML. Gain expertise in CSS to design and styles web pages.

JavaScript with ES6/TS

Master JavaScript, a programming language for building interactive web elements and adding functionality to web applications

Frontend Frameworks

Explore popular frontend frameworks like React JS, Angular, which facilitate building dynamic and responsive user interfaces.

Server Side Programming

Gain proficiency in server-side programming languages like Java, Python, or PHP to handle server logic and database interactions.

Database

Learn to work with databases such as MySQL, MongoDB to store, retrieve, and manipulate data.

API Development

Understand how to create API for communication between frontend and backend components of web applications.

Full Stack Web Projects

Master yourself in Full Stack Career Skills by diving into a series of full stack projects that seamlessly blend front-end and back-end technologies.

Project 1
E-Commerce Platform

Build a fully functional e-commerce platform from scratch, incorporating essential features like user authentication, product management, shopping cart functionality.

Project 2
Portfolio website

Portfolio website created using HTML, CSS, Bootstrap, and JavaScript is a dynamic and visually appealing platform for showcasing one's professional work and achievements.

Project 3
Task Management Applications

Develop a comprehensive task management application with features such as user registration, task creation, deadline tracking, and collaboration functionalities using React JS.

Project 4
Blog CMS

Create a blog content management system with CRUD operations, authentication, and comment features using Python and MongoDB.

Project 5
Chat Application

Build a real-time chat application using WebSockets that supports user login, group chats, and message storage.

Final Project
Capstone Integration

Combine all your skills in a final project integrating frontend, backend, database, and deployment using full stack tools.

Full Stack Certification Course

A full stack developer Certification Course equips individuals with the necessary skills to handle both front-end and back-end tasks effectively. This certification is in high demand as it validates the expertise of professionals in this rapidly evolving field.

Front End Developers: Develop and create user interface systems with HTML5, CSS3, Bootstrap Framework, JavaScript, and React JS or Angular Framework.

Back End Developers: Develop and create API for Back End Development System using Java, SpringBoot and MySQL or Python, Django with RestAPI.

The Full Stack Development Practical Classes by Hejex Technology stands out from other training programs due to its Expert-Led Full Stack Developer Programme. This means that the classes are conducted by experienced industry professionals who have a deep understanding of the Full Stack Program as per company standards. This ensures that students receive high-quality instruction and guidance throughout their learning journey. Furthermore, Full Stack Course with placement assistance, helps students secure job opportunities in the IT industry.

Full Stack Job Roles

  • Full Stack Developer
  • Software Engineer
  • Back End Developer
  • Web Developer
  • Front End Developer
  • Associate Engineer
Full Stack Course Overview

Interested in Mastering Full Stack Training in Chennai with Hejex Technology?

Join a small group of only 5 students. You will get top-notch training, live sessions, and personal mentorship. Learn from leading industry experts.

Next Batch Starts Soon • Certification Included • Real-Time Projects

Full Stack Training in Chennai

Career Kick Start

Full Stack Development Certification Course is designed to be accessible to beginners while providing challenges and insights that are valuable for those with some prior experience in web development. With a focus on practical skills.

Real World Scenarios

Full Stack Online Live Training, Real World Scenarios often involve case studies, simulations, or hands-on projects that simulate the challenges and problem-solving requirements encountered in real-world settings.

Industry Experts

Industry Experts are individuals who have accumulated extensive experience, knowledge, and expertise within a specific field or industry. These professionals are recognized for their deep understanding of industry trends and best practices.

Full Stack Developer Certification Course

  • Hejex Technology's Full Stack Web Developer Program is a comprehensive and industry-focused course that aims to equip freshers with the necessary skills to succeed in the field.

  • As the Full Stack Training Institute in Chennai designed by experienced professionals who have a deep understanding of the industry and its requirements. By taking our Full Stack Online Live Training, students can expect to gain a solid foundation in web development and be well-prepared to take on real-world projects.

Full Stack Developer
Salary in India
400,000
Minimum
600,000
Average
750,000
Maximum
  • Hejex Technology understands the importance of staying up-to-date with the Full Stack Web Developer Training, which is why the syllabus is regularly updated to incorporate the latest trends and advancements in the industry.

  • This ensures that students are equipped with the most relevant and in-demand skills when they enter the job market. Whether you are a fresher looking to kickstart your career or an experienced professional looking to upskill, Hejex Technology’s Full Stack Web Developer Program is the perfect choice for you.

Get a Free Callback

Explore the best course for your goals.

Full Stack Course FAQ'S

Hejex Technology in Chennai is the best institute for Full Stack Developer course in chennai due to its stellar reputation, experienced instructors, hands-on learning approach, holistic development focus, and strong support system. Choosing Hejex Technology will undoubtedly provide aspiring Full Stack Developers with an exceptional learning experience and set them up for a successful career in the field.

Hejex Technology is the best choice for Full Stack developer training in tambaram is their emphasis on hands-on learning. Throughout the course, students are provided with ample opportunities to apply their theoretical knowledge in practical scenarios, thus strengthening their understanding of various concepts and technologies. This hands-on approach ensures that students are job-ready and can confidently tackle real-world challenges upon graduation.

The scope of a Full Stack Developer is vast and constantly evolving. A Full Stack Developer is someone who is proficient in both front-end and back-end development, meaning they have the skills to work on both the client-side and server-side of an application or website.The scope of a Full Stack Developer is broad and includes a wide range of technical skills and responsibilities.

Overall, being a full stack development requires a combination of technical skills, problem-solving abilities, and effective communication. It is an ever-evolving role that requires continuous learning and staying updated with the latest technologies and trends in web development.

A full stack developer is someone who has the knowledge and skills to work on both the front end and back end of a web application. This means that they are proficient in both client-side and server-side technologies and can handle all aspects of web development.

Our Testimonials

Full Stack Course Reviews

What is Full Stack?

Full Stack Development combines both the client side and server side of a website. Hence the full-stack developers hold expertise in frontend and backend frameworks and languages. Regarding the front end, it includes HTML5, CSS3, Bootstrap, JavaScript, React JS, or Angular for a platform. On the other hand, the backend consists of a database server with an API, Then a Core programming Language, and a BackEnd Framework for the corresponding Language.

How can become a full stack developer?

Becoming a full stack developer will require you to take a round on various technologies both on Front-End as well as Back-End technologies with Databases. If you want to be a full-stack developer, just start coding, by selecting a language and start your front-end projects until you gain confidence in it. The more you do the actual coding and build projects instead of reading theory, the more you will learn

What skills are needed for a Full Stack Developer?

Key skills include:
Proficiency in front-end and back-end languages and frameworks
Understanding of database management
Knowledge of version control systems like Git
Familiarity with DevOps practices and tools
Problem-solving and debugging

How long does it take to become a Full Stack Developer?

If you are planning to become a skilled Full Stack Developer, by creating awesome websites and web applications then it might take you around 4 to 5 months. It may vary based on your knowledge of Coding or new to coding. At Hejex Technology you can become a skilled Full Stack Developer with the guidance of Industry Experts by doing 3 Real Time Projects 2 projects on front end and 1 Project will be for Full Stack with an API call. Your Full Stack projects denote how strong you a Full Stack Developer.

Is there any eligibility criteria to become a Full Stack Developer?

Initially, Full Stack Developers have come from a Computer Science or Engineering background. Since the Growth of Web Development frameworks and other tools, people from other backgrounds, such as Arts & Commerce can also become Full Stack Developers. Few Full Stack Developer Courses might require students to have computer proficiency and basic knowledge of programming. To get placed as a Full Stack Developer you must have a Bachelor's degree with a minimum CGPA which may vary on the organization.

WhatsApp Chat
Full Stack Developer Course Fees at 34,999/- Only